What Exactly Is OpenAI ChatGPT Group Chat?

Group Chat in ChatGPT is a new feature that lets multiple users join a shared conversation — all powered by AI. Think of it as:

  • A WhatsApp group

  • But instead of friends chatting, you collaborate inside ChatGPT

  • And the AI responds to everyone in the same thread

This is extremely useful for:

  • Study groups

  • Teams working on a project

  • Writers collaborating on ideas

  • Developers debugging code together

  • Friends exploring AI tools

  • Content creators brainstorming topics

In the past, if you wanted to share a ChatGPT output, you had to take screenshots, crop them, and send them manually. Group Chat eliminates all of that. Now, you can simply send an invite link, and the other person joins your ongoing ChatGPT conversation instantly.


Who Can Use Group Chat in India? (Important!)

While the feature is now visible across India, there’s one major limitation that users need to understand:

Group Chat works only on the ChatGPT Go Plan

The Go plan is currently free for one year for Indian users and includes access to:

  • GPT-4.1

  • Image generation

  • Voice mode

  • Group Chat

Group Chat does NOT work on the free plan

If you are still on the free plan, the “Add People” button will not appear.
Users need to activate Go Plan (which costs ₹0 for one year) to unlock access.

This is an important detail because many users assume it’s a global rollout for everyone. Technically yes — but practically, only Go plan users in India can start or join group chats.


How to Create a Group Chat in ChatGPT (Step-by-Step Guide)

1. Click “Add People” from the Left Sidebar

Once you login to ChatGPT (web or mobile), you will see a new option on the left panel called “Add People”.
This is the entry point for creating a group chat.

2. A “Start Group Chat” Popup Appears

After clicking Add People, a small window opens.
Here, you simply click “Start Group Chat”.

This confirms that you want to create a group conversation and not just invite someone to a standalone chat.

3. The Invite Link Screen Opens

Next, ChatGPT automatically generates a unique invite link.
This screen also provides sharing options like:

  • Gmail

  • WhatsApp

  • Google Drive

  • Messages

  • Copy Link

  • More sharing apps depending on your device

Just tap the method you prefer.

4. Share the Invite Link With Anyone You Want to Add

Once you share the link, the other person only needs to open it.
It works in one click — no complicated login or extra confirmation steps.

5. Group Chat Opens Instantly on All Devices

After they accept the invite, the group chat loads instantly on both devices.
You’ll see the same conversation, the same AI response, and the same prompts in real time.

For example, you typed:
“Latest tech news today”
And the response appeared simultaneously on both screens.

This makes ChatGPT feel like a live collaborative workspace — something users have wanted for a long time.

Limitations You Should Know

While the feature is impressive, there are a few important limitations:

Available only on ChatGPT Go Plan

Not on the free version.

Works only when all participants use supported plans

If the person joining doesn’t have access, they won’t be able to open the link.

No long list of features yet

Currently, it’s more like shared chat — not a full group management system.

Still, considering it’s the first version, the experience is surprisingly polished.
